What happened Pavel Bure?
Bure struggled with knee injuries throughout his career, resulting in his retirement in 2005 as a member of the Rangers, although he had not played since 2003. He averaged better than a point per game in his NHL career (779 points with 437 goals in 702 NHL games) and is fourth all-time in goals per game.

Why did Pavel wear 96?
96 to honor the day he arrived in North America to play for the Vancouver Canucks on Sept. 6, 1991. But Canucks coach Pat Quinn did not like the idea of high numbers, so Bure was given No. 10, the number he wore with the Soviet Union national team.
Is Bure Russian?
Communism was on the brink of collapsing in Bure’s homeland, and he was one of the first Russian nationals to make the move West for a chance to play in a different league. His final destination was Vancouver, who had drafted him in the 1989 NHL Entry Draft.

What is the hockey fighting code?
“The Code” of NHL fighters includes this maxim: don’t turtle. For those who aren’t familiar with the term, turtling is when a player initiates a fight and then covers up like a turtle going into his shell without actually throwing a punch. This move is considered dishonorable.

Was Pavel Bure a captain?
Pavel Bure In 223 games, he scored 251 points and during his lone season as captain, he had 92 points in 82 games. He is currently the Panthers’ third-highest goalscorer with 152 and also leads the franchise in hat tricks with 10.
